Job description

Bioinformatician (Medical & Drug Discovery)

Oxford (2 days a week onsite)

Competitive (Up to £75,000, DOE) + Annual Bonus and Excellent Benefits

Join a cutting-edge leader in medical and drug discovery, harnessing the power of bioinformatics to drive breakthroughs in healthcare. If you're passionate about using computational methods to solve complex biological problems and contribute to the future of medicine, we want to hear from you.

Role Overview:

As a Bioinformatician, you'll work at the intersection of biology, data science, and drug discovery. You’ll analyze large-scale genomic, clinical, and molecular datasets to extract meaningful insights that fuel innovation in biomedical research. Collaborating closely with data scientists, machine learning engineers, and scientific experts, your work will have a direct impact on the development of new therapies and treatments.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Analyze and interpret genomic, transcriptomic, proteomic, and clinical data to support drug discovery projects.
  • Develop and optimize bioinformatics tools and pipelines for high-throughput data analysis.
  • Collaborate with machine learning engineers and biologists to design data-driven experiments and interpret results.
  • Use bioinformatics software and databases to uncover insights into disease mechanisms and potential therapeutic targets.
  • Apply statistical models and computational methods to identify biomarkers, drug targets, and other key biological insights.
  • Stay up-to-date with the latest bioinformatics techniques, software, and trends in drug discovery.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s, Master’s, or PhD in Bioinformatics, Computational Biology, or a related field.
  • Strong proficiency in programming languages like Python, R, or Perl for data analysis.
  • Experience with bioinformatics tools and databases (e.g., BLAST, Bioconductor, Ensembl).
  • Solid understanding of genomics, transcriptomics, proteomics, and other omics data.
  • Familiarity with cloud platforms (AWS, GCP, Azure) and high-performance computing.
  • Experience with statistical analysis, machine learning, or data visualization tools (e.g., R, MATLAB, Jupyter).
  • Strong communication skills to collaborate across teams and present findings to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.

Desirable:

  • Experience with next-generation sequencing (NGS) data analysis and pipelines.
  • Knowledge of molecular biology, cheminformatics, or systems biology.
  • Familiarity with data privacy and regulatory considerations in healthcare AI.
